Detecting Leaks for Minimal Damage
Water leaks can cause significant damage rapidly if left undetected. Performing regular leak detection checks can help reveal potential problems early on, minimizing the extent of damage and preventing costly repairs.
- Examine your pipes regularly for any signs of damage.
- Track your water bill for any unusual fluctuations.
- Pay attention to for wet spots on walls.
If you suspect a leak, it's important to take immediate action and contact a qualified plumber for expert assistance.

Cutting-Edge Techniques for Effective Leak Detection
Detecting leaks can be a difficult task, but progresses in technology have led to powerful leak detection techniques. These methods often utilize sophisticated sensors capable of pinpointing even the smallest seeps. Ultrasonic leak detection systems analyze sound waves or variations in air pressure to pinpoint the location of a leak.
Gas imaging techniques can detect heat signatures, revealing leaks in pipelines. Furthermore, some tools employ data analysis to process sensor data and anticipate potential leaks before they become major concerns.
Periodically implementing these modern leak detection techniques can substantially reduce the frequency and severity of leaks, leading to cost savings and enhanced operational efficiency.
